      Meaning of the first name Hasan

      Origin

      Arabic

      Meaning

      Handsome

      Variations

      Hasana, Hasani, Asani
      The name Hasan is derived from the Arabic language and holds the meaning of handsome or beautiful. Its origins can be traced back to ancient Arab culture, where it was commonly bestowed upon boys as a reflection of their physical attractiveness. The name Hasan gained prominence due to its association with important historical figures and its usage within prominent dynasties. Notably, it appears in the history of the Islamic world, where several individuals named Hasan played significant roles.

      In history, one of the most renowned bearers of the name Hasan was Hasan ibn Ali, the grandson of the Islamic prophet Muhammad. Hasan ibn Ali was cherished for his charismatic personality and was regarded as a symbol of compassion and wisdom. His role as the second Imam of the Shi'a Muslims further enhanced the significance of the name Hasan within the Islamic tradition. Over the centuries, a number of other historical figures named Hasan emerged, holding positions of power and influence across various regions.

      Today, the name Hasan continues to be widely used, both within Arabic-speaking communities and among individuals with an affinity for Arabic names. Its inherent connotation of physical attractiveness has made it a popular choice for parents seeking names that embody beauty. Additionally, the historical significance of the name Hasan adds an element of prestige and cultural heritage to its modern-day usage. Whether as a first or last name, Hasan remains a timeless and meaningful choice, embodying both a physical ideal and a connection to a rich historical lineage.
